plenty of people take boats like yours on the river. As long as you know your boat real well and understand how it will react to the current, swells, wind, and waves you'll be fine. The current up near the lower dam can be squirly, don't let it pull you into the white water!! You need your motor to be rock solid dependable so if you get into trouble it will start right up. Take your safety equipment/ wear your life jacket and go catch some fish.
One other thing: where you are planning on crossing the river can be one of the most difficult parts. The current from the upper and lower dams come together right there and it can be exciting in the current break. Sometimes it helps to let the river take you down stream a little bit as you cross, then back track up in the calmer water. No need in fighting it. Be carefull.
